Key Account Manager- Cattle (West Region)

Vaxxinova US is extending its commercial organization and is seeking an experienced individual to join the team as a Key Account Manager- Cattle (West Region – CA and AZ). About the role:

The Key Account Manager- Cattle is responsible for Front Line Business and Account management with Key Cattle Accounts. The role will apply a Key Account Management approach to cultivate networks and relationships with Veterinarians, Key Producers, and Distribution to leverage Vaxxinova’s resources to drive sales growth. The role will represent Vaxxinova at key industry events, meetings and with Key Opinion Leaders (KOL’s). This position requires about 70% travel.

This position requires availability to travel about 70% of business time.

Main responsibilities:
  • Leverage resources, build relationships & networks to identify opportunities for customers, deliver and drive sales results.
  • Identify emerging needs and trends for Key Accounts, Vaxxinova and the industry, communicating these needs to the broader Vaxxinova team.
  • Develop & execute account plans (looking 12-18 months out), including sales forecasting, and supporting customers thru field visits.
  • Lead account teams that create and capture the most value for Vaxxinova and for customers. Work across company functions to bring maximum value & a good customer experience for Key Accounts.
  • Represent Vaxxinova at key industry & customer meetings and work to influence KOL’s to
  • Demonstrate Vaxxinova’s emerging leadership in the vaccine space.

About Vaxxinova

Vaxxinova provides a wide range of both autogenous and licensed vaccines combined with high-level diagnostic services, supported by strong R&D. Our focus is on livestock including cattle, poultry, swine and aqua. Vaxxinova US, formerly known as Epitopix and Newport Laboratories, is the US operating unit of Vaxxinova International, headquartered in the Netherlands. Vaxxinova US has a strong market presence making autogenous vaccines for cattle, swine, and poultry as well as a state-of-the-art diagnostic laboratory. Vaxxinova currently has facilities in fourteen countries including Brazil, Canada, Chile, Colombia, Croatia, Italy, Germany, Japan, Jordan, Norway, South Africa, Thailand, the USA, and the Netherlands. Vaxxinova is part of the family-owned EW Group, headquartered in Germany. The EW Group specializes in animal genetics, animal nutrition and animal health, operates in over 100 countries and records consistent international growth.
